Comprehending the Types of Driver’s Licenses in Poland
Before diving into the application process, it is important to understand the kinds of driver’s licenses readily available in Poland. The country problems numerous categories of licenses depending upon the type of automobile one wishes to operate.

| License Category | Description | Minimum Age | Training Required |
|---|---|---|---|
| AM | Moped and some motorbikes | 14 | Yes |
| A1 | Motorcycles up to 125cc | 16 | Yes |
| A | All bikes | 24 * | Yes |
| B | Automobiles (approximately 3.5 loads) | 18 | Yes |
| C | Trucks (over 3.5 heaps) | 21 | Yes |
| D | Buses | 24 | Yes |
| E | Trailers (when integrated with B, C, or D) | 21 | Yes |
* Age can be lowered to 20 if a two-year driving license for category A1 has actually been held.
Steps to Apply for a Polish Driver’s License
The application process for a Polish driver’s license usually includes the following actions:
1. Meet the Eligibility Criteria
- Age Requirement: Ensure you meet the minimum age requirement for the desired license category.
- Residency: Be a legal citizen of Poland or hold a momentary home permit.
2. Medical Examination
- Discover an Authorized Physician: Schedule a medical checkup with a physician licensed to conduct driver assessments.
- Obtain a Medical Certificate: The doctor will provide a certificate verifying your physical and mental capability to drive. This certificate is compulsory for the application.
3. Enrollment in a Driving School
- Choose a Driving School: Select a certified driving school in your area. Make sure to confirm its qualifications.
- Complete Training Hours: Depending on the classification of the driver’s license, you will undergo a specified variety of training hours, consisting of both theoretical classes and useful driving.
4. Theoretical and Practical Exams
- Pass the Theoretical Exam: The examination covers traffic regulations, road indications, and safe driving practices. It is carried out in Polish however might provide English and other translations upon request.
- Pass the Practical Exam: This exam evaluates your driving abilities behind the wheel.
5. Submit the Application
- Gather Required Documents: You need to gather all necessary documents, which usually include:
- Completed application (readily available at the regional office)
- Identity document (ID or passport)
- Residency proof
- Medical certificate
- Evidence of completed driving training
- Payment invoice for the application fee
- Send to Local Authorities: The application, in addition to the essential documents, ought to be submitted to the regional Department of Communication (Wydział Komunikacji).
6. Get Your License
- When approved, you will get a plastic driver’s license card mailed to your signed up address.
Costs Associated with the Driver’s License Application
The expenses can differ depending upon the driving school and the charges in your area. Here’s a basic breakdown of costs:
| Expense Type | Approximated Cost (PLN) |
|---|---|
| Medical Examination | 150 – 300 |
| Driving School Fees | 1,500 – 3,000 |
| Theoretical Exam Fee | 30– 100 |
| Practical Exam Fee | 150 – 300 |
| Application Fee | 100 – 200 |
| Overall Estimated Costs | 1,930 – 3,900 |
Note: Prices may vary by region and might change in time.

2. Is it possible to drive in Poland with a foreign motorist’s license?
- Yes, individuals can generally drive in Poland for as much as 6 months on a valid foreign driver’s license. Longer stays might require a Polish license.
3. What takes place if I fail my driving test?
- You can retake the useful exam after a designated waiting duration, typically two weeks. Keep in mind that repeated failures may need extra training.
4. Can I request a different classification after obtaining one?
- Yes, you can look for additional classifications, but you need to finish the proper training and examinations for those categories.
5. Exist any special arrangements for foreign citizens?
- Some towns might have specific rules for foreigners. It’s advisable to consult regional authorities or a licensed driving school for precise information on foreign resident applications.
